For Brodus: Between the new investment in the giant disco ball, the increased role and focus placed on the girls, and the fact that the guy is now beginning to get wins over more credible, "established" talent, Brodus Clay is probably the most dumb-lucky guy in wrestling today. With so many other "monster" characters floating around the company at the moment (Lesnar, Tensai, Ryback), Brodus would've simply receded into the Superstars shadows as "The Fat One" had he debuted with his original gimmick. Instead, he's giddily stumbled into a role that, while not main event championship material, the company obviously sees as a profitable, sustainable character, an effective comedy break between all of the arm snapping and Laurinaitis-derived chicanery.
For Miz: Wow. Just...wow. Last year, the first heel since Triple H a decade prior to walk out of WM as champion. This year, getting placed into glorified squash matches against comedy characters like Santino and the "Funkasaurus". I'm not saying the guy is going to get released (with him starring in "Marine 3", that's obviously not happening), but I think his fate as an eternal mid-carded has more or less been sealed.
I like Miz, or at least I did in 2009/10 when he had fire in his belly and a chip on his shoulder, but as I watched Extreme Rules and the 3 awesome main events, and the caliber of talent involved in them (Cena, Brock, Punk, Jericho, Bryan, Sheamus), I couldn't help but think that Miz is simply outclassed. He can cut as many "Mean Face" promos as he wants, but the main event scene in WWE is just too stacked with gifted athletes right now for him to ever seem a credible champion. If all of those guys get injured, and Lord Tensai leaves, and ADR breaks his leg, and Kane is on sabbatical, and they can't convince Batista to come back, then maybe Miz could be champ again, but just maybe.
